在JavaScript编程中,我们经常会遇到需要对数字进行分割和处理的情况。比如,你可能需要将一个数字按照特定的规则分割成多个部分,以便进行后续的计算或处理。本文将带你一起探索如何轻松拆解JS中的数字,特别是以“123_223”这样的格式,并掌握数字分割的技巧。
了解数字分割的基本概念
首先,我们需要了解什么是数字分割。简单来说,数字分割就是将一个数字按照一定的规则拆分成多个部分。在JavaScript中,我们可以使用字符串操作、正则表达式等方法来实现数字分割。
字符串操作
在JavaScript中,我们可以使用字符串的split()方法来根据指定的分隔符将字符串分割成数组。例如:
let number = "123_223";
let parts = number.split("_");
console.log(parts); // 输出: ["123", "223"]
在上面的代码中,我们使用下划线“_”作为分隔符,将数字“123_223”分割成了两个部分:“123”和“223”。
正则表达式
除了字符串操作,我们还可以使用正则表达式来实现数字分割。正则表达式是一种强大的文本处理工具,可以用来匹配和操作字符串。以下是一个使用正则表达式分割数字的例子:
let number = "123_223";
let parts = number.match(/(\d+)/g);
console.log(parts); // 输出: ["123", "223"]
在上面的代码中,我们使用了正则表达式\d+来匹配一个或多个数字,并将匹配到的结果存储在数组中。
拆解JS中的“123_223”
现在,我们已经了解了数字分割的基本概念,接下来我们来具体拆解JS中的“123_223”。
分割步骤
- 首先,我们需要确定分割的规则。在这个例子中,分割规则是下划线“_”。
- 使用字符串操作或正则表达式将数字按照分割规则分割成数组。
- 对分割后的数组进行处理,例如进行计算或转换。
示例代码
以下是一个拆解“123_223”的示例代码:
let number = "123_223";
let parts = number.split("_");
console.log(parts); // 输出: ["123", "223"]
// 对分割后的数组进行处理
let sum = parseInt(parts[0]) + parseInt(parts[1]);
console.log(sum); // 输出: 346
在上面的代码中,我们首先使用split()方法将“123_223”分割成数组,然后使用parseInt()函数将数组中的字符串转换为整数,并计算它们的和。
总结
通过本文的介绍,相信你已经掌握了在JavaScript中拆解数字的技巧。在实际编程过程中,你可以根据具体需求选择合适的分割方法,并灵活运用这些技巧。希望这篇文章能帮助你更好地理解和应用数字分割技术。
